Aim - 1 | Lab Module 11: Final Project / Open-Ended Design Challenge | VLSI Design Lab
K12 Students

Academics

AI-Powered learning for Grades 8–12, aligned with major Indian and international curricula.

Professionals

Professional Courses

Industry-relevant training in Business, Technology, and Design to help professionals and graduates upskill for real-world careers.

Games

Interactive Games

Fun, engaging games to boost memory, math fluency, typing speed, and English skills—perfect for learners of all ages.

1 - Aim

Practice

Interactive Audio Lesson

Listen to a student-teacher conversation explaining the topic in a relatable way.

Introduction to the Aim of the Project

Unlock Audio Lesson

Signup and Enroll to the course for listening the Audio Lesson

0:00
Teacher
Teacher

Welcome, class! Today, we begin our final project. Can anyone share what they think the main aim of this project will be?

Student 1
Student 1

I think it will help us use everything we learned in class.

Teacher
Teacher

Exactly! The goal is to integrate all your knowledge into a single, coherent design. This will involve creating a complete digital circuit. Remember, it's a chance to apply what you've learned practically.

Student 2
Student 2

What are some specific aspects we should focus on during this project?

Teacher
Teacher

Great question! You'll need to pay attention to systematic design processes, documentation, and analysis. Each of these elements plays a critical role in successful design.

Student 3
Student 3

What do you mean by systematic design process?

Teacher
Teacher

Good point! A systematic design process involves stages like specification, architectural design, and functional simulation, among others. It's a methodical way of creating your design, similar to constructing a building.

Student 4
Student 4

So we need a plan before we start designing?

Teacher
Teacher

Yes! Planning is essential. It ensures that we have a clear direction and know what inputs and outputs our circuit will handle.

Teacher
Teacher

In summary, the aim of this project is to combine your learning into a real-world application through a systematic approach. It's your chance to shine!

Understanding Design Methodology

Unlock Audio Lesson

Signup and Enroll to the course for listening the Audio Lesson

0:00
Teacher
Teacher

Now, let’s get into the specifics of the design methodology. What do we start with in a systematic design process?

Student 1
Student 1

We start with the specification of what the circuit needs to do.

Teacher
Teacher

Correct! Specification answers the critical question: 'What does the circuit need to do?' It's about defining inputs and expected outputs.

Student 2
Student 2

What comes next after the specification phase?

Teacher
Teacher

Next is architectural design, where we outline the major sections or blocks of our circuit and their connections. This is where we start visualizing our project.

Student 3
Student 3

And then we draw the actual schematics, right?

Teacher
Teacher

Exactly! That’s the logic design phase. After that, we will conduct functional simulations to ensure everything works as intended. Do any of you remember why functional simulation is important?

Student 4
Student 4

It's to check if the circuit logic is correct before worrying about speed or layout!

Teacher
Teacher

Spot on! The correct operation of logic is paramount. Finally, we have to document everything thoroughly at each phase, as it’s critical for communication and collaboration.

Teacher
Teacher

In summary, follow the design methodology - specification, architectural design, logic design, functional simulation, and thorough documentation.

Real-world Application of VLSI Concepts

Unlock Audio Lesson

Signup and Enroll to the course for listening the Audio Lesson

0:00
Teacher
Teacher

Let’s talk about how this project is relevant to the real world. Why do you think understanding these concepts is important for future engineers?

Student 1
Student 1

Because in the industry, we will have to design circuits that work efficiently!

Teacher
Teacher

Exactly! The industry expects engineers to combine various components into complex systems. You will face similar design challenges as we do in this module.

Student 2
Student 2

What about documentation? Is it really that important?

Teacher
Teacher

Yes, it is! Good documentation ensures that your work can be understood and built upon by others. It prevents misunderstandings and mistakes.

Student 3
Student 3

So, the open-ended nature of this project allows us to demonstrate our creativity?

Teacher
Teacher

Absolutely! Creativity and problem-solving are key skills in engineering. This project will require you to think outside the box and make design decisions responsibly.

Teacher
Teacher

In conclusion, the relevance of this project extends far beyond the classroom, preparing you for real-world challenges by integrating theoretical and practical knowledge.

Challenges and Expectations

Unlock Audio Lesson

Signup and Enroll to the course for listening the Audio Lesson

0:00
Teacher
Teacher

As we embark on this project, what challenges do you think we might face?

Student 1
Student 1

Debugging can be frustrating if something doesn’t work right.

Teacher
Teacher

Yes, debugging is often time-consuming. It’s about patience and perseverance. Understanding your circuit thoroughly will help you!

Student 2
Student 2

How can we ensure we don’t miss anything during the design phase?

Teacher
Teacher

Good question! Staying organized and maintaining clear documentation throughout the process will help you keep track of your ideas and decisions.

Student 3
Student 3

What if we realize we need to change our design halfway through?

Teacher
Teacher

Flexibility is crucial in engineering. If you encounter challenges, analyze them and adjust your design accordingly. Be prepared for iterations!

Student 4
Student 4

I'm excited but a little nervous about all the tasks ahead!

Teacher
Teacher

That’s completely normal! Remember, this project is a learning experience. Approach each task step by step, and don't hesitate to ask for help.

Teacher
Teacher

In summary, anticipate challenges, stay organized, and remain flexible. This is an opportunity for growth!

Introduction & Overview

Read a summary of the section's main ideas. Choose from Basic, Medium, or Detailed.

Quick Overview

The primary aim of this lab module is to integrate learned VLSI design concepts into a real-world project involving the design and verification of a digital circuit.

Standard

This section details the objectives of the final project in digital VLSI design, emphasizing the integration of course concepts into a practical circuit design, the implementation of a systematic design process, and the importance of documentation and analysis in tackling design challenges.

Detailed

Aim Overview

The Aim of this lab module is to bring together all the concepts and skills learned throughout the course of Digital VLSI Design. Students will tackle a real, integrated digital design project that requires them to design a circuit from its conceptualization to a verified simulation. This exercise highlights the systematic design process, the necessity for clear documentation, and the need for thorough analysis of results. Ultimately, this module prepares students for future real-world challenges in chip design.

Key Objectives:

  1. Integration of Knowledge: Utilize everything learned—from basic gates to layout verification—to solve a comprehensive design problem.
  2. Step-by-step Design Methodology: Follow the established process of circuit specification, architectural design, schematic capture, functional simulation, and beyond.
  3. Real-world Application: Emphasize the importance of practical design experience in preparing for industry roles.
  4. Documentation Practices: Underline the importance of maintaining clear and organized documentation for design choices, simulation results, and methodologies employed.

Audio Book

Dive deep into the subject with an immersive audiobook experience.

Main Goal of the Project

Unlock Audio Book

Signup and Enroll to the course for listening the Audio Book

The main goal of this exciting final lab module is for you to bring together everything you've learned in this course. You'll take all the concepts and practical skills – from designing simple gates to understanding memory and verifying layouts – and use them to tackle a real, integrated digital design problem.

Detailed Explanation

This chunk emphasizes that the primary objective of the final project is to consolidate knowledge acquired throughout the course. It highlights that students will need to apply various concepts, such as designing simple components and understanding memory functionalities. The focus is on the integration of these skills to address a real-world digital design challenge, moving from theoretical learning to practical application.

Examples & Analogies

Imagine a chef who has learned different cooking techniques throughout their career. In this project, the chef will prepare a complete meal, combining various techniques to create a delicious dish. Similarly, students will blend their knowledge of digital design to create an effective circuit.

Designing a Circuit

Unlock Audio Book

Signup and Enroll to the course for listening the Audio Book

You'll design a circuit from its initial idea all the way to a verified simulation. This project will truly emphasize a systematic way of designing, the importance of clear documentation, and how to thoroughly analyze your results.

Detailed Explanation

The project entails a comprehensive process of circuit design that begins with conceptualization and ends with a validated simulation. This step-by-step progression highlights the necessity of a structured approach in design, ensuring that students not only create a functioning circuit but also understand the implications of their choices through thorough documentation and analysis of their outcomes.

Examples & Analogies

Think of building a piece of furniture. A carpenter starts with a design sketch, gathers materials, constructs the piece step by step, and finally checks the structure for stability and quality. Likewise, students will follow a process to develop their digital circuit, starting from their idea to a fully verified simulation.

Preparation for Industry Challenges

Unlock Audio Book

Signup and Enroll to the course for listening the Audio Book

This experience will be a big step towards preparing you for actual chip design challenges in the industry.

Detailed Explanation

This chunk emphasizes the project's role in simulating real-world scenarios that professionals face in the field of chip design. By engaging in this integrated design challenge, students are not only learning technical skills but are also being prepared for the collaborative and problem-solving nature of industry work, making them more equipped when they enter the job market.

Examples & Analogies

Consider an athlete who trains under competition conditions to prepare for a big match. The final project serves as a training ground for students to apply what they've learned in a setting that mimics the demands of real-world chip design.

Definitions & Key Concepts

Learn essential terms and foundational ideas that form the basis of the topic.

Key Concepts

  • Integration of Knowledge: Applying all learned VLSI concepts into a practical project.

  • Design Methodology: Following a systematic approach consisting of specification, architectural design, logic design, etc.

  • Documentation Importance: Maintaining clear records to enhance understanding and collaboration in design.

Examples & Real-Life Applications

See how the concepts apply in real-world scenarios to understand their practical implications.

Examples

  • Designing a 4-bit adder involves combining full adders and logic gates to accomplish a summation task.

  • Creating a finite state machine (FSM) for a traffic light controller to manage sequences based on state changes.

Memory Aids

Use mnemonics, acronyms, or visual cues to help remember key information more easily.

🎵 Rhymes Time

  • In designing a circuit, let’s not stray, with clear steps in mind, we’ll find our way.

📖 Fascinating Stories

  • Imagine building a LEGO house. First, you need to plan what it’ll look like (specify), gather your pieces (architectural design), then start connecting them (logic design). Finally, check your house is sturdy before showing it to friends (functional simulation).

🧠 Other Memory Gems

  • S-A-L-F-D. Remember: Specification, Architectural Design, Logic Design, Functional Simulation, and Documentation.

🎯 Super Acronyms

P.A.L. helps with design

  • Plan
  • Assemble
  • Launch for your circuit!

Flash Cards

Review key concepts with flashcards.

Glossary of Terms

Review the Definitions for terms.

  • Term: Specification

    Definition:

    The process of defining what a circuit needs to do, including inputs and outputs.

  • Term: Architectural Design

    Definition:

    The phase where the main sections or blocks of a circuit are organized and connected.

  • Term: Logic Design

    Definition:

    The phase involving the detailed creation of circuit schematics using logic gates and elements.

  • Term: Functional Simulation

    Definition:

    A process of testing whether a circuit works as intended based on its logical design.

  • Term: Documentation

    Definition:

    The written record of design choices, circuit schematics, and test results that facilitates understanding and collaboration.

  • Term: Critical Path

    Definition:

    The longest delay path in a circuit that determines its maximum operating speed.